This week on the Romance Writers Weekly Blog Hop, we've been asked to share "one of your favorite reviews for one of your books." Oh, this one is soooo easy.

I've received many wonderful reviews over the years, but I think the review that's touched me the most is one I received for my book Inked Memories, which has a heroine who is a cancer survivor. In part the reviewer has this to say, "We can read fiction, and it can touch us, but I think sometimes when it touches on shared scars it becomes more real and helps us feel not so alone. Thank you for that P.G. Forte"

There are times when writing is hard, times when writers block, or impostor syndrome, or a lack of sales has you thinking that maybe it's time to quit. It's reviews like this that make it all worthwhile and help me keep going.

All Sophie wants is a tattoo to commemorate her battle with cancer. What she gets is celebrity tattoo artist Declan Ross, the same sexy bad-boy who, once-upon-a-time, used to rock her world. 

 With his hit television show on hiatus, Declan is back in the Big Easy. A charity event at Midnight Ink, the shop where he got his start, seems like the perfect opportunity to use his celebrity status to publicize a good cause...and just maybe improve his own image in the process. The last thing he's expecting, or thinks he needs, is a chance meeting with the girl he left behind. 

 Last time they were together, Declan was the one who was damaged. This time, they've both got scars; and those you can't see are the hardest to cover.
